AV57 XLT is a 2007 Mitsubishi L200 Double Cab in Silver with a 2,477cc diesel engine. This vehicle has been through 22 MOT tests with a personal pass rate of 59.1%.
Across all 2007 Mitsubishi L200 Double Cab models, the average MOT pass rate is 70.7% with a typical mileage of 89,184 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Mitsubishi L200 Double Cab fails its MOT is brake pipe excessively corroded, accounting for 41,357 recorded failures. If you're considering buying AV57 XLT, it's worth having these areas checked by a mechanic before committing.
The Mitsubishi L200 Double Cab typically stays on UK roads for around 27 years. At 19 years old, this Mitsubishi L200 Double Cab is well into its expected lifespan but still has years ahead.
